Output 34a81d6658101947c9178588b15134a1f53aa5aaa1442685aa727f95a8f1a7fa:0

value
101103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26527f494cd26e5d9b74d0ba39f0363ae7c5cc42 OP_EQUAL
address
35BeRqgMxu8VgZbddwFATCpmoZWHug3ohg
transaction
34a81d6658101947c9178588b15134a1f53aa5aaa1442685aa727f95a8f1a7fa
confirmations
554145
spent
true